Objectives

The primary objective of this prospective Phase II study is to evaluate the **safety** and **efficacy** of the Fludarabine plus Treosulfan (14g) (FT14) conditioning regimen for allogeneic Stem Cell Transplantation (allo-SCT) in patients with **Acute Myeloid Leukemia (AML)** aged between 40 and 65 years who are in complete morphological remission (CR/CRi/MLFS). This evaluation is clinically relevant as it aims to determine the potential of the FT14 regimen to improve outcomes in AML patients undergoing allo-SCT, a critical treatment option for this patient population.

Inclusion and Exclusion Criteria

check_circle

Inclusion Criteria

  • Patients >40 <65 years of age
  • Diagnosis of AML in first CR/CRi/ MLFS
  • Eligible for allo-SCT from HLA-identical matched related or unrelated donor as defined by molecular high-resolution typing (4 digits) at the following four HLA gene loci (HLA-A, B, C, and DRB1)
  • Adequate hepatic function (bilirubin ≤2 UNL; ALT/AST ≤2,5 UNL)
  • Adequate renal function (creatinine clearance ≥50 ml/min)
  • ECOG Performance Status < 2
  • Willing and able to comply with all of the requirements and visits in the protocol
  • Written and signed informed consent
cancel

Exclusion Criteria

  • AML patients with t(15;17); t(8;21); inv(16)
  • Subject has known active CNS involvement with AML
  • Grade >2 NCI-CTCAE (v. 5) adverse events at the time of enrollment
  • Serious organ dysfunction: left ventricular ejection fraction < 40%, FEV1, FVC, DLCO (diffusion capacity) <40% of predicted, LFT > 5 times the upper limit of normal, or creatinine clearance < 40 ml/min
  • The evidence of HBV or HCV active infection (HBV DNA, HCV RNA positive test)
  • Patients with HIV infection
  • Current uncontrolled infections
  • Patients with other life-threatening concurrent disease
  • Subjects with known hypersensitivity to any of the component medication
  • Participation in another clinical trial within 1 month before the start of this trial
  • Participant, both female and male, in childbearing age who do not agree to maintain active contraceptive practice
  • Pregnant or lacting patients during screening
